TECHNICAL DATA IN74HC11A Triple 3-Input AND Gate High-Performance Silicon-Gate CMOS The IN74HC11A is identical in pinout to the LS/ALS11. The device inputs are compatible with standard CMOS outputs; with pullup resistors, they are compatible with LS/ALSTTL outputs. • Outputs Directly Interface to CMOS, NMOS, and TTL • Operating Voltage Range: 2.0 to 6.0 V .
